The book accompanied the reformer throughout his life, growing in size from what was essentially an expanded catechism in 1536 to a fullscale work of biblical theology in 15591560. Beginning with the second edition of his work published in 1541, calvin translated each new version into french, simultaneously adapting the text to suit lay audiences, shaping it subtly but clearly to teach, exhort, and encourage them.
